In this vibrant exhibition presented by Museum of Brisbane in partnership with Brisbane Powerhouse’s Melt Festival, contemporary artist Gerwyn Davies showcases a striking series of photographic portraits exploring identity, transformation and visibility. Featuring trans and gender-diverse young people from Open Doors Youth Service, each subject appears in a handcrafted sculptural costume co-created with the artist during workshops held as part of Davies’ artist-in-residence project at Museum of Brisbane.
These wearable artworks allow participants to express themselves in spectacular ways while maintaining anonymity, playfully and powerfully reimagining trans and gender-diverse visibility. The final works are exhibited in the Fairfax Gallery, amplifying the voices of the participants and the broader LGBTQIASB+ community.
